Tragic Hero

A tragic hero is a character in a literary work who possesses noble qualities, but eventually meets a tragic demise due to their fatal flaw or a combination of external circumstances and their own actions. This term is commonly used in literary analysis to describe the central character in a tragedy.

Sense 1: Literary Definition

Noun

  1. A main character in a tragedy, typically of high social status, who undergoes a downfall due to their own flaws.

Example sentence: Othello, the tragic hero in Shakespeare's play, is consumed by jealousy, leading to his ultimate downfall and the demise of those around him.
